Hello I'm having two issues with my Samsung galaxy Z Flip 3. I've only had the phone 5 months now and the screen cover is starting to crack at the fold and there is a lifted spot on the right have side that I can feel and hear make a slight popping sound when I move my finger over it. Second issue is the phone now shuts off when I fold it unless it is hooked to it's charger. I've done a wipe and factory reset and the problem was not fixed. At this point the phone is unusable as intended. What are my options?

I am having the same issue. Because of the scrach on the back side of the hinge the Samsung also doesn't accept the warranty. I also attach the photo of a scracth so you can se it what is the problem. I have this scratch about 6 months but the phone is having this issue now, so in my oppinion this scratch has nothing to do with this problem. I am also very disappointed with Samsung response.
For now I am havng the phone connected to the power bank all the time and it works fine but this is not a permanent solution.
I recommend everyone that have this model of phone that you take the insurance, because I doubt that anyone phone that is older than one year is without a scratch.
